Output 84c5b6d8f718cf5f10bc94e788e04944d88feb126fc270d699d224f6a6ae43ea:1

value
112743453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07eef0bdafa5789bfab373003e0c05267c256e5 OP_EQUAL
address
3LhSXxWA9wYnyewFTHLEKVmMB8Bfkjympm
transaction
84c5b6d8f718cf5f10bc94e788e04944d88feb126fc270d699d224f6a6ae43ea